Latest Patents

Hermann holds a patent for N-phenylbenzamide derivatives, which are described by the general formula I. These compounds, wherein the radicals R¹, R², and R³ can be either a hydrogen atom or a methyl radical, have pharmacologically acceptable salts. They are designed for controlling malignant, proliferative, and autoimmune diseases, as well as for immunosuppressive therapy during grafting procedures.
